Elements and Performance Criteria
- Plan work for shift
- Oversee system set-up
- Assess hazards associated with samples and identify the need for specific safety equipment and safe work procedures
- Determine job sequence after consideration of the dryness of samples, need for further drying or pre-treatment and client/production priorities
- Record job sequence and confirm details with operators
- Check that sample preparation parameters assigned to each sample are appropriate and adjust as necessary
- Conduct pre-use system checks, make necessary system adjustments and authorise start-up
- Monitor system performance and recover from errors and breakdowns
- Conduct regular visual checks to identify signs of malfunction, equipment wear or impending system failure
- Interpret error codes and analyse system/equipment outputs to investigate the nature of problems
- Shut down and/or isolate faulty system components to enable safe investigation and continuation of unaffected work tasks
- Troubleshoot causes of common system problems and take appropriate corrective actions within scope of responsibility and technical competence
- Seek advice when problems are beyond scope of responsibility or knowledge
- Arrange for servicing and/or repairs in response to mechanical breakdowns
- Prior to re-start, conduct pre-use checks, adjust job sequence and sample preparation parameters and re-synchronise system components as necessary
- Maintain system safety
- Check that that safety equipment and required PPE is available and fit for purpose
- Conduct regular checks to ensure that operators work safely when handling hazardous samples, operating the system and performing authorised cleaning/maintenance of system components
- Maintain system records
- Maintain the security, integrity and traceability of samples and system documentation
- Record and report system/equipment use, errors, breakdowns, maintenance and repairs in accordance with workplace procedures
- Contribute to system improvements
- Examine system logs and outputs to identify instances or emerging trends of sub-standard performance
- Recommend appropriate preventative/corrective actions for improving performance to relevant personnel
- Implement authorised system improvements
- Train operators to improve performance and minimise recurrence of preventable problems
